![]() Customization options are greater with Cubase, allowing users to tailor the interface to their specific needs.įL Studio is generally considered easier to use out-of-the-box but lacks in advanced customization options. However, Cubase provides a more complex level of control. Usability and NavigationĬomparing usability and navigation between Cubase and FL Studio, it’s evident that they both offer intuitive layouts. When comparing Cubase and FL Studio in terms of interface and workflow, two important considerations are usability and navigation, as well as MIDI and VST support.īoth programs offer a user-friendly layout that is easy to navigate, but they differ when it comes to the way they organize their tools.Ĭubase offers extensive MIDI sequencing capabilities while FL Studio utilizes a pattern-based approach for creating complex rhythmical elements.Īdditionally, both platforms have extensive support for plug-ins, allowing users to easily expand their sound palette with third party instruments and effects.
